Death of Ray Jones
Date published: 07 June 2016
THE local bowling fraternity are mourning the loss of Ray Jones, at the age of 77.
Ray played a huge part in the running of the Chadderton League for two decades. As well as serving on the executive committee, he also held the roles of match secretary and secretary.
A former player, Ray had an association with the Deaf Club.
STERLING
League chairman Peter Gartside said: "He was a nice guy, who did sterling work for the Chadderton League.
"It's people like Ray that are the lifeblood of local leagues. He will be sadly missed."
The funeral takes place at Oldham Crematorium on Friday (3.30pm).
